The Science of Leadership: Nine Ways to Expand Your Impact
Nine science-backed leadership capacities, drawn from over fifteen thousand studies, that help any leader model, inspire, and empower others to perform at their best. Two Thinkers50 Award-winning experts in neuroscience, emotional intelligence, and organizational behavior distill decades of research into a practical, progressive framework built around 9 capacities organized across 3 levels: self-oriented, other-oriented, and system-oriented. Each capacity is grounded in real stories, science summaries, and hands-on practices and includes guidance on avoiding the pitfalls of overuse. Inside this book:
What readers gain: Greater ease in leading, reduced ego-driven friction, stronger team outcomes, and a sense of fulfillment that grows alongside impact. Ideal for leaders who want research-backed development, not generic advice.
- A 9-capacity framework built on over fifteen thousand studies in human performance
- Tools for becoming more conscious, authentic, relational, compassionate, and transformational as a leader
- Practices applicable at every level, from emerging managers to C-suite executives and professional coaches
- Real-world stories that make complex behavioral science immediately actionable
